Article: EPA REACHES AGREEMENT WITH WISCONSIN COMPANY ON CLEAN-AIR VIOLATIONS

CHICAGO, Oct. 8 -- The Environmental Protection Agency Region 5 office issued the following news release:

U.S. Environmental Protection Agency Region 5 has reached an agreement with A & A Manufacturing Co. Inc. on alleged clean-air violations at the company's metal and rubber products manufacturing plant at 2300 S. Calhoun Road, New Berlin, Wis.

The agreement, which includes a $79,429 penalty and two environmental projects costing $22,280, resolves EPA allegations that A & A operated its plant from 1995 to the present without a state operating permit that would require the company to limit its emissions of hazardous air pollutants and volatile organic compounds.
